Liquidations: A Sign of the Times?
Late October 2025 saw a staggering $2.95 billion in leveraged crypto positions liquidated in just 24 hours. This indicates the inherent risk in leveraged trading, where borrowed funds amplify both potential gains and losses. When prices move against a leveraged trade, exchanges automatically close positions to cover losses, triggering liquidation cascades.
Earlier in the year, volatile sessions led to nearly $817 million in liquidations, with long traders bearing the brunt. CoinGlass data highlighted how overextended leverage can be, with Hyperliquid, Bybit, and Binance leading in liquidation volumes.
Fed Caution: Damping Enthusiasm
Adding to the market's uncertainty is the Federal Reserve's stance on monetary policy. While a rate cut may have been anticipated, cautious comments from Fed Chair Jerome Powell have tempered expectations for further easing. This caution reflects concerns about inflation remaining above target and limited room for maneuver amid potential government shutdowns.
As BTSE's COO Jeff Mei pointed out, further easing is unlikely unless economic weakness becomes more pronounced. This creates a risk-averse environment, impacting crypto markets.
